Why Voip is for you

Why Voip is for you

The internet is definitely changing the way we communicate with each other. We can reach anyone else in the world, providing that person also has access to the internet.   We can send and receive emails, chat, and talk. We can get engaged in video conferences, and what not.

It is not always the newest technology what counts, though. Nowadays, when we want to communicate with someone else, we can still use the plain old telephone system. As a matter of fact, we can reach more people in the world using a simple telephone than through the internet!

Now, what if we could have the best of both worlds?

What if we could call those ones who have access to the internet to their own computers, while being able to call and those ones who only have a telephone number, all from the same computer?

What if we could save on long distance calls, to the extent of being able to make certain overseas calls that would otherwise be unaffordable?

What if we could be reached on our local telephone number or computer from overseas at a low cost so that if we have friends or relatives abroad or far away we can provide them of a means of reaching us at a low cost?

What if we could enjoy the benefits of a better service than a telephone line, at a lower cost, with or without having to use a computer ourselves?

Well, that is what VOIP can mean to you! All you need is a computer with speakers and microphone (or a proper headset) or the VOIP equipment (usually supplied by the VOIP provider), and a connection to the internet.

With VOIP, you can:

  • Make phone calls from your computer to other computers or telephone numbers anywhere in the world.
  • Use it as a normal telephone if you prefer not to use a computer (you will still need a connection to the internet)
  • Save big on long distance calls.
  • Move your current telephone number to VOIP so as to get a better service at a lower cost.
  • Have a virtual number overseas so that you can be called at the cost of a local call. For example: you are studying in the USA and your mother lives in Tokyo. You get a local telephone number in Tokyo and your mother can call you (at the cost of a local call for her) to anywhere you are in the USA (or, in the world, for that matter)
  • Get an overseas low cost toll-free number for your business.
  • Make long distance calls from your mobile phone at a surprisingly low cost, or get a second line for your mobile phone.
